危重症成年患者液体平衡与体重变化测量值之间的相关性

The Correspondence Between Fluid Balance and Body Weight Change Measurements in Critically Ill Adult Patients.

Abstract

INTRODUCTION

Positive fluid status has been associated with a worse prognosis in intensive care unit (ICU) patients. Given the potential for errors in the calculation of fluid balance totals and the problem of accounting for indiscernible fluid losses, measurement of body weight change is an alternative non-invasive method commonly used for estimating body fluid status. The objective of the study is to compare the measurements of fluid balance and body weight changes over time and to assess their association with ICU mortality.

METHODS

This prospective observational study was conducted in the 34-bed multidisciplinary ICU of a tertiary teaching hospital in southern Brazil. Adult patients were eligible if their expected length of stay was more than 48 hours, and if they were not receiving an oral diet. Clinical demographic data, daily and cumulative fluid balance with and without indiscernible water loss, and daily and total body weight changes were recorded. Agreement between daily fluid balance and body weight change, and between cumulative fluid balance and total body weight change were calculated.

RESULTS

Cumulative fluid balance and total body weight change differed significantly among survivors and non survivors respectively, +2.53L versus +5.6L (p= 0.012) and -3.05kg vs -1.1kg (p= 0.008). The average daily difference between measured fluid balance and body weight was +0.864 L/kg with a wide interval: -3.156 to +4.885 L/kg, which remained so even after adjustment for indiscernible losses (mean bias: +0.288; limits of agreement between -3.876 and +4.452 L/kg). Areas under ROC curve for cumulative fluid balance, cumulative fluid balance with indiscernible losses and total body weight change were, respectively, 0.65, 0.56 and 0.65 (p= 0.14).

CONCLUSION

The results indicated the absence of correspondence between fluid balance and body weight change, with a more significant discrepancy between cumulative fluid balance and total body weight change. Both fluid balance and body weight changes were significantly different among survivors and non-survivors, but neither measurement discriminated ICU mortality.

摘要

引言

在重症监护病房(ICU)患者中,正液体平衡与较差的预后相关。鉴于液体平衡总量计算中存在误差的可能性以及难以察觉的液体丢失的核算问题,测量体重变化是一种常用的替代非侵入性方法,用于估计体液状态。本研究的目的是比较随时间变化的液体平衡测量值和体重变化,并评估它们与ICU死亡率的关联。

方法

这项前瞻性观察性研究在巴西南部一家三级教学医院的34张床位的多学科ICU中进行。成年患者如果预期住院时间超过48小时且未接受口服饮食,则符合入选标准。记录临床人口统计学数据、有无不可察觉失水量时的每日和累积液体平衡以及每日和总体重变化。计算每日液体平衡与体重变化之间以及累积液体平衡与总体重变化之间的一致性。

结果

幸存者和非幸存者的累积液体平衡和总体重变化分别存在显著差异,分别为+2.53L对+5.6L(p = 0.012)和-3.05kg对-1.1kg(p = 0.008)。测量的液体平衡与体重之间的平均每日差异为+0.864 L/kg,区间较宽:-3.156至+4.885 L/kg,即使在对不可察觉的液体丢失进行调整后仍然如此(平均偏差:+0.288;一致性界限在-3.876至+4.452 L/kg之间)。累积液体平衡、有不可察觉液体丢失时的累积液体平衡和总体重变化的ROC曲线下面积分别为0.65、0.56和0.65(p = 0.14)。

结论

结果表明液体平衡与体重变化之间缺乏对应关系,累积液体平衡与总体重变化之间的差异更为显著。幸存者和非幸存者之间的液体平衡和体重变化均存在显著差异,但两种测量方法均无法区分ICU死亡率。
